Gateway limitations
Dear All,
Since two days i have a problem with data refreshing on my account.
I'm getting sync error that 'Uncompressed data received on the client gateway, crossed the limit.'
There is no further information, about kind of limitation. Is that on rows or total size limitation?

You can take a look at below article which mentions about this issue:
Data limit here is not related to model size. It is related to how much data is being transferred during refresh. There is a 10 GB limit on that. Users model can be 488 MB but if he is downloading more than 10 GB during refresh it will fail. Please provide RAID's if you want us to investigate new refresh failures. There is no data download limits in PBI desktop so it will be successful over there. For more information please see.
https://powerbi.microsoft.com/en-us/documentation/powerbi-gateway-onprem-tshoot/
Error: The received uncompressed data on the gateway client has exceeded limit. The exact limitation is 10 GB of uncompressed data per table. If you are hitting this issue, there are good options to optimize and avoid the issue. In particular, reducing the use of highly repetitive, long string values and instead using a normalized key or removing the column (if not in use) will help.

Thank You very much, that's exactly may problem.
I will try to reduce useless columns, if they are still there.
edit: I have removed 3 useless columns from my data source, and it works again, but I'm affraid that it will help me for a month maybe. Is there any way to check how much data is transferred during refresh?
